Willy van der Meeren Wardrobe for Tubax, Belgium 1950

About the Item

A fantastic wardrobe designed by Willy Van Der Meeren, manufactured by Tubax in Belgium in 1952. This eye-catching, rare piece is made of beautiful quality wood on a black metal structure. The large metal sliding doors are executed in two different colours, one white and one light green, giving the piece a unique appeal and beautiful modern touch! Together with the organic shaped wooden handles, the piece combines practicality with style and craftsmanship. The doors reveal a nice spacious interior with a coat rack on the left and black shelves on the right side. This provides plenty of storage capacity and all together makes this wardrobe a fantastic addition to the interior! A highly recognizable cabinet by one of Belgium’s most iconic mid-century designers. It’s a truly outstanding piece! Sold individually – the price is per piece! It remains in very good, vintage condition with minor wear consistent with age and use, preserving a beautiful patina. The doors have been professionally restored.
